Geographic Location of Kendupati


The village Kendupati is located in Athmallik Police Station Jurisdiction of Anugul District in the State of Odisha in India. It is governed by Luhasinga Gram Panchayat. It comes under Athmallik Community Development Block. The nearest town is Athamallik, which is about 15 kilometers away from Kendupati.

Social Structure of Kendupati


As per available data from the year 2009, 134 persons live in 35 house holds in the village Kendupati. There are 71 female individuals and 63 male individuals in the village. Females constitute 52.99% and males constitute 47.01% of the total population.

There are 69 scheduled tribes persons of which 38 are females and 31 are males. Females constitute 55.07% and males constitute 44.93% of the scheduled tribes population. Scheduled tribes constitute 51.49% of the total population.

Population density of Kendupati is 197.06 persons per square kilometer.

Land and Natural Resources in Kendupati

Total area of Kendupati is 68 Hectares as per the data available for the year 2009.

Total sown/agricultural area is 22.4 ha. About 22.4 ha is un-irrigated area.

About 4.81 ha is in non-agricultural use. About 1.66 ha is used permanent pastures and grazing lands. About 3.83 ha is under miscellaneous tree crops.

About 22.4 ha is lying as current fallow area. About 0.01 ha is culturable waste land. About 10.71 ha is covered by barren and un-cultivable land.
